In this paper, Madison argues against Thomas Jefferson’s assertion that two out of three branches should be able to call a convention to modify the constitution. Madison illustrates that this principle will centralize the legislative branch while taking away power from the other two branches. Nevertheless, igniting instability in the federal government while additionally making the legislative branch the judge, jury, and executioner.
